What is a Pram?
A pram, brief for "perambulator," is a kind of lorry developed particularly for infants. It includes a completely reclining seat or bassinet, so a baby can lie flat while being transported. This is particularly important for newborns whose spinal columns are still establishing. Prams often have larger wheels, offering a smoother trip on numerous surfaces.

A pushchair is a light-weight alternative often utilized for young children. Unlike prams, pushchairs generally include a seat that can sit upright and may not use a completely reclining option, making them ideal for older babies who can support their heads and necks. Many modern pushchairs featured various functions geared towards convenience for the parent and comfort for the kid.

Can you utilize a pushchair for a newborn?
While numerous modern-day pushchairs provide reclining seats that can be utilized for newborns, it's usually recommended to use a pram or a pushchair with a bassinet choice for appropriate support.
2. How long can you use a pram or a pushchair?
Prams are normally used for infants as much as 6 months, while pushchairs can be appropriate for children as much as 4 years or more, depending upon the model.
3. Are prams more costly than pushchairs?
Prams are often pricier due to their design, flexibility, and products. However, costs can vary commonly depending on brand name, functions, and age suggestions.
4. Is it required to have both a pram and a pushchair?
Not necessarily. Many parents select a 2-in-1 system that combines both features, enabling them to adapt as their kid grows.
5. What should I focus on in picking one?
Prioritize safety functions, comfort, weight, size, and how well it suits your way of life. Read evaluations, and test drive various models when possible.
